#InPictures: Parchment ceremony welcomes 38 newly-admitted solicitors

Pictured: Newly-qualified solicitors presented with their parchments
New members of the solicitor profession were presented with their parchments and prizes at the latest parchment ceremony in Blackhall Place.
Mr Justice Michael Quinn of the High Court and former Justice Minister Frances Fitzgerald addressed the ceremony, along with Law Society president Michael Quinlan.

Pictured: Prizewinners at the parchment ceremony
There were 55 presentations last Wednesday, including 38 newly-qualified solicitors being presented with their parchment.
